The Gilching team left no doubts in their 8-0 friendly win against Indersdorf. The eyes of the national league team are now on the state government decision.

Gilching - TSV Gilching-Argelsried is also not stingy with goals in the evening. After groundskeeper Gerald Söhnel and department head Stefan Schwartling have made sure that no one enters the gravel arena apart from the players, coaches, supervisors, referees and press representatives, the match can begin. The guests from Markt Indersdorf have already moved and entered the stadium through the entrance on the other side. “You have to go home without a shower, because our showers are still blocked,” says Schwartling. The national division has little trouble with the regional division from the Dachau hinterland and wins 8-0 after three 30 minutes.

"It was ok for the first test," says coach Peter Schmidt, who seems a bit restless on the sidelines. “We are waiting for the birth of our third child. The actual due date was on Friday, ”he explains. After all, his unusually goal-hungry team offers him a little variety. "It was a lot of fun to finally be able to play again," says TSV veteran Christoph Meißner. However, one of the Corona rules seems contradictory to him. “The referee must wear a mask when checking players. He's allowed to get very close to us on the field, ”he says, surprised.

Meanwhile, his department head is looking forward to the beginning of the week. “I assume that a decision will be made on Monday as to how things will continue,” says Schwartling, who attended a webinar organized by the Bavarian Football Association (BFV) on Friday. In his opinion, it could well be that the weekend games were the last of the year. Because if the Bavarian State Government should decide in its unscheduled meeting on Monday that no spectators are allowed in September either, the association's restart plans will probably be invalid.
